Output 66952bb7795c314e76dccbe0439702990c54751ee40be1e2b9254b4da67eb247:12

value
447430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01034ae36f57fa6e90634cf9281e1112a9c4de9b OP_EQUALVERIFY OP_CHECKSIG
address
16McxjtdkZxcuiu25T28Z1338vSvYCTt6
transaction
66952bb7795c314e76dccbe0439702990c54751ee40be1e2b9254b4da67eb247
spent
true